4.15 Assessment of CALPUFF for Modeling Winter-Time PM_(10) in Christchurch, New Zealand

Christchurch, in New Zealand's South Island, has PM_(10) concentrations in winter that exceed the WHO 24-hour guidelines. CALPUFF has been used to model the distribution of PM_(10) concentrations across the city of Christchurch during winter 2005 and 2006. CALMET was shown to effectively develop the terrain induced surface flows that affect Christchurch on light-wind evenings. The modeling of wintertime PM_(10) in the city was verified against measured data at two sites. The model captured diurnal variability well but daily values were generally too high, although the long term averages were shown to be within 10% of the measured values. The model was able to predict high pollution days with reasonable skill, with a rank correlation of 0.63 to 0.80.
